2012-11-28 70 views

回答

5

如果一个方法被重载,它是否继承了父类的原始方法 ?

是的,你可以使用它们两个。

压倒一切呢?它会继承原来加上 覆盖的吗?

再次 - 是的,但在这种情况下,要访问原始方法,您将不得不使用呼叫super.originalMethod()

0

在超载的情况下,在父类的方法仍然是在子类中使用。

在压倒一切的情况下,不运行父的版本,除非明确调用的方法使用super.method()

1

如果方法被重载,它是否仍然继承父类的原始方法?

是的。

什么压倒一切?

是的,但overidden方法不能被其他类访问。

它也会继承原来加上重写的吗?

是的。